Now that you mention it, I did come across the duplicate problem. I didn't fix it for icecast but I put a quick check in the live365 module by having a variable that holds the last sent and if its the same as what is about to send, it does nothing.

We encounter a different problem, I dont know if it helps.
When two songs are separated by short liners of 2-3 seconds our RLM
Shoutcast module updates with the previous track. In details, as an
example
1) Beatles -> shoucast writes Beatles
2) 2 secs liner -> this group doesnt have Now/Next
1) Rolling Stones -> shoutcast writes Beatles again.
2) ..
I think the reason is that - in this example - Beatles has a segue
longer than the liner, but I am not sure.
